LEARNING OUTCOMES OF THE COURSE UNIT |
At the end of this course, the students; 1) Has the knowledge of definitions and intended uses of financial statements 2) Learns the meaning and preparation of basic and additional financial statements. 3) Will be able to analyze financial statements of a company by using financial analysis techniques. 4) Knows how to prepare financial statements for users. 5) Learns to prepare and analyze and interpret consolidated financial statements.

COURSE DEFINITION | In this course, general characteristics and usage limits of financial statements, Content and preparation studies of basic and additional financial statements, financial analysis techniques and their use, adjustment of financial statements according to price movements will be evaluated. |
